  9. I wonder if anyone has photos, and is willing to post them, of the trip to Chernobyl when we played Ukraine in 2006. I spent yesterday watching the whole series and it brought back memories of that day. Sadly, I didn't have a camera and my phone then just did phone calls and texts (maybe played music too, I cannae mind). I was watching with my wife who I met that same year in Lithuania and she can hardly believe that we even wanted to go there so pictures would help šŸ˜€ She was especially interested in the series as it was filmed in Vilnius and even spotted her flat which she still has and rents out. She was a little bit annoyed at the end when they only mentioned the devastating effect it had on Ukraine and Belarus - Lithuanian people also have higher cancer rates etc as a result of the disaster. She has often said how angry she feels that. as a child, she and her friends were not warned by the Soviet officials about the dangers of playing outside immediately following the disaster. Anyway, memories of the trip..... The site of the funfair, going for a wee meal served up by the good ladies of Chernobyl, someone dropping a whole loaf of bread in the river and one of the huge fish coming up and swallowing it in a oner Worrying on the way out when being scanned that I'd be too radioactive to be allowed back to Kiev šŸ˜Ž So, thanks in advance for any pictures
